  • 1. What Cytomegatect is and what it is used for

Cytomegatect

  • belongs to the group of immunoglobulins. These medicines contain antibodies (antibodies are part of the body's immune system).
  • contains antibodies directed against cytomegalovirus.
  • is a solution for infusion administered as an intravenous "drip" (infusion) into a vein.

Cytomegatect is given for the prevention of clinical manifestations of cytomegalovirus infection in patients receiving immunosuppressive therapy (a treatment that suppresses the immune system), particularly in patients who have received a transplant.
During administration of Cytomegatect, your doctor will consider the concomitant use of appropriate antiviral agents.

Information on safety regarding infections
Cytomegatect is made from human plasma (the liquid part of blood). When medicines are manufactured from human blood or plasma, certain precautions are taken to prevent transmission of infections to patients through the administration of the medicine. All blood donors are tested for viruses and infections. In addition, the manufacturing process includes steps that can inactivate or remove viruses.
Despite these measures, the risk of transmitting infections through medicines made from human blood or plasma cannot be completely excluded.
The measures taken are considered effective against viruses such as

  • human immunodeficiency virus (HIV),
  • hepatitis A virus (HAV),
  • hepatitis B virus (HBV),
  • hepatitis C virus (HCV).

The measures taken may have limited effectiveness against viruses such as

  • parvovirus B19.

To date, no associations have been found between immunoglobulins and infections caused by hepatitis A virus or parvovirus B19, probably because the antibodies contained in Cytomegatect provide protective activity against these infections.
It is strongly recommended that, for each dose of Cytomegatect administered, the name and batch number of the medicine be recorded. The batch number allows tracing back to the specific starting material used for the medicine administered to you. Therefore, if necessary, a link can be established between you and the material used as starting substance.

Other medicines and Cytomegatect
Tell your doctor or pharmacist if you are taking, have recently taken, or might take any other medicines.
Cytomegatect may reduce the effectiveness of certain vaccines, such as vaccines against

  • measles
  • rubella
  • mumps
  • varicella. After receiving Cytomegatect, you should wait up to 3 months before being vaccinated with certain vaccines; and up to 1 year in the case of the measles vaccine.

Avoid concomitant use of loop diuretics (commonly known as water tablets) with Cytomegatect.

  • 3. How to use Cytomegatect

Cytomegatect is administered by your treating physician.
The recommended dose is 1 ml per kg of body weight per day for adults, children, and adolescents.
You will receive this medicine for a total of at least 6 times, at intervals of 2-3 weeks. Your doctor will
determine exactly how many infusions you need and when to start treatment.
Cytomegatect is administered as an intravenous "drip" (infusion). The medicine must be brought to room or body temperature before use.
If you receive more Cytomegatect than you should
An excessive amount of Cytomegatect may increase fluid volume and cause hyperviscosity (thickening) of the blood, particularly if you are over 65 years of age and/or have reduced cardiac or renal function.

4. Possible side effects

Like all medicines, this medicine can cause side effects, although not everybody gets them.
The following side effects of Cytomegatect are based on spontaneous reports:
Not known: frequency cannot be estimated from the available data

  • Anaemia (haemolytic anaemia)
  • Severe allergic reaction such as anaphylactic shock, anaphylactic reactions, anaphylactoid reactions, hypersensitivity
  • Headache, dizziness
  • Vomiting
  • Skin reactions including rash, abnormal redness of the skin, itching
  • Joint pain
  • Blood test results indicating impaired kidney function (increased serum creatinine) and/or acute kidney failure
  • Chills, fever, fatigue

Normal human immunoglobulin preparations can generally cause the following side effects (in decreasing order of frequency):

  • chills, headache, dizziness, fever, vomiting, allergic reactions, nausea, joint pain, low blood pressure, and moderate back pain
  • reduction in the number of red blood cells due to their destruction within blood vessels (haemolytic reactions (reversible)) and (rarely) haemolytic anaemia requiring transfusion
  • (rarely) sudden drop in blood pressure and, in isolated cases, anaphylactic shock
  • (rarely) transient skin reactions (including cutaneous lupus erythematosus – frequency not known)
  • (very rarely) thromboembolic reactions such as heart attack (myocardial infarction), stroke, blood clots in the blood vessels of the lungs (pulmonary embolism), blood clots in a vein (deep vein thrombosis)
  • cases of temporary acute inflammation of the protective membranes covering the brain and spinal cord (reversible aseptic meningitis)
  • cases of blood test results indicating impaired kidney function and/or acute kidney failure
  • cases of acute transfusion-related lung injury (TRALI). This leads to a build-up of fluid, unrelated to the heart, in the lung alveoli (non-cardiogenic pulmonary edema). You will experience severe breathing difficulty (respiratory distress), increased breathing rate (tachypnea), abnormally low levels of oxygen in the blood (hypoxia), and increased body temperature (fever).

What Cytomegatect contains
The active substance is: human anti-cytomegalovirus immunoglobulin (CMVIG)
1 ml of solution contains:
50 mg of human plasma proteins, of which immunoglobulin G (IgG) ≥ 96%,
with an anti-cytomegalovirus (CMV) antibody content of 100 U*.
Each 10 ml vial contains: 500 mg of human plasma proteins (of which at least 96%
immunoglobulin G), with an anti-CMV antibody content of 1,000 U*.
Each 50 ml vial contains: 2,500 mg of human plasma proteins (of which at least 96%
immunoglobulin G), with an anti-CMV antibody content of 5,000 U*.
The percentage distribution of IgG subclasses is approximately 65% IgG1, 30% IgG2, 3% IgG3, 2% IgG4.
Maximum content of immunoglobulin A (IgA) is 2,000 micrograms/ml.
* units of the reference preparation of the Paul-Ehrlich-Institute
Other components are: glycine, water for injections.

Dosage and administration
Administration should begin on the day of transplantation. In the case of bone marrow transplantation, prophylaxis may start up to 10 days before transplantation, particularly in CMV-seropositive patients. A total of at least six doses should be administered at intervals of 2–3 weeks apart.

Route of administration
For intravenous use.
Cytomegatect is administered intravenously at an initial infusion rate of 0.08 ml/kg body weight/h for 10 minutes. In case of adverse reaction, reduce the infusion rate or discontinue the infusion. If the product is well tolerated, the infusion rate may be gradually increased up to a maximum of 0.8 ml/kg body weight/h for the remainder of the infusion.

Warnings and precautions
Certain severe adverse reactions may be related to the infusion rate. The recommended infusion rate must be strictly observed, and patients must be closely monitored and observed for the onset of symptoms throughout the entire duration of the infusion. Certain adverse reactions may occur more frequently in cases of:

  • high infusion rate,
  • patients receiving normal human immunoglobulin for the first time, or, rarely, when switching to a different normal human immunoglobulin preparation, or after a long interval since the previous infusion.

Potential complications can often be avoided by ensuring that patients:

  • are not sensitive to normal human immunoglobulin by starting with a slow initial infusion rate (0.08 ml/kg body weight/h),
  • are closely monitored for any symptoms during the infusion period. In particular, patients who have never been treated with normal human immunoglobulin, patients previously treated with another intravenous human immunoglobulin (IVIg), or those who have had a long interval since the last infusion, must be monitored in hospital during the first infusion and for the first hour after completion of the infusion to detect potential adverse signs. All other patients should be observed for at least 20 minutes after administration.

In case of adverse reactions, the infusion rate should be reduced or the infusion stopped. The required treatment depends on the nature and severity of the adverse reaction. In case of shock, standard medical treatment for shock should be initiated.

For all patients, administration of IVIg requires:

  • adequate hydration before starting the IVIg infusion,
  • monitoring of urinary output,
  • monitoring of serum creatinine levels,
  • avoidance of concomitant use of loop diuretics.

Hypersensitivity
Hypersensitivity reactions are rare and may occur in patients with anti-IgA antibodies.
Anaphylaxis may develop in patients:

  • with undetectable IgA who have anti-IgA antibodies,
  • who have previously tolerated treatment with human immunoglobulin.

In case of shock, standard medical treatment for shock should be initiated.

Thromboembolism
There is clinical evidence of an association between intravenous immunoglobulin (IVIg) administration and thromboembolic events such as myocardial infarction, cerebrovascular accident (stroke), pulmonary embolism, and deep vein thrombosis. In at-risk patients, these events are believed to be related to the rapid influx of immunoglobulins, leading to a relative increase in blood viscosity. Caution should be exercised when prescribing and infusing immunoglobulins in the following patient groups: overweight patients and patients with pre-existing risk factors for thrombotic events (such as advanced age, hypertension, diabetes mellitus, history of vascular disease or thrombotic episodes, patients with acquired or hereditary thrombophilic disorders, patients undergoing prolonged immobilization, patients with severe hypovolemia, and patients with conditions that increase blood viscosity).
In patients at risk of thromboembolic adverse reactions, IVIg products should be administered at the lowest possible infusion rate and dose.

Acute renal failure
Cases of acute renal failure have been reported in patients receiving intravenous immunoglobulin (IVIg) therapy. In most cases, risk factors such as pre-existing renal insufficiency, diabetes mellitus, hypovolemia, overweight, concomitant nephrotoxic therapy, or age over 65 years have been identified.
Renal function parameters should be checked before IVIg infusion, particularly in patients considered at potentially increased risk of developing acute renal failure, and repeated at appropriate intervals. In patients at risk of acute renal failure, IVIg products should be administered at the lowest feasible infusion rate and dose.
In the presence of renal dysfunction, discontinuation of immunoglobulin therapy should be considered.
Although cases of renal dysfunction and acute renal failure have been associated with the use of many authorized IVIg products containing various excipients such as sucrose, glucose, and maltose, products containing sucrose as a stabilizer have been linked to an unusually high proportion of total cases. In at-risk patients, the use of immunoglobulin products free from these excipients may be considered. Cytomegatect does not contain sucrose, glucose, or maltose.

Aseptic meningitis syndrome (AMS)
AMS has been reported in association with intravenous immunoglobulin (IVIg) therapy. The syndrome usually begins within several hours to 2 days after IVIg treatment. Cerebrospinal fluid (CSF) analyses often show pleocytosis up to several thousand cells/mm³, predominantly granulocytes, and elevated protein levels up to several hundred mg/dL. AMS may occur more frequently with high-dose IVIg treatment (2 g/kg). Patients presenting with such signs and symptoms should undergo a thorough neurological evaluation, including CSF analysis, to exclude other causes of meningitis. Discontinuation of IVIg therapy has led to resolution of AMS within a few days without sequelae.

Hemolytic anemia
Intravenous immunoglobulins (IVIg) may contain blood group-specific antibodies that can act as hemolysins and induce in vivo coating of erythrocytes with immunoglobulins, resulting in a positive direct antiglobulin test (Coombs test) and, rarely, hemolysis. Hemolytic anemia may develop following IVIg therapy due to increased sequestration of erythrocytes. Patients receiving IVIg should be monitored for clinical signs and symptoms of hemolysis.

Neutropenia/Leukopenia
Transient reduction in neutrophil count and/or episodes of neutropenia, sometimes severe, have been reported after IVIg treatment. This typically occurs within hours or days of IVIg administration and resolves spontaneously within 7–14 days.

Transfusion-related acute lung injury (TRALI)
Cases of acute non-cardiogenic pulmonary edema [Transfusion-Related Acute Lung Injury (TRALI)] have been reported in patients receiving IVIg. TRALI is characterized by severe hypoxia, dyspnea, tachypnea, cyanosis, fever, and arterial hypotension. TRALI symptoms usually develop during or within 6 hours after infusion, often within 1–2 hours. Therefore, recipients of IVIg should be monitored, and IVIg infusion should be immediately stopped in case of pulmonary adverse reactions. TRALI is a potentially life-threatening condition requiring immediate management in an intensive care unit.

Interference with serological tests
Following administration of immunoglobulin, the transient increase in various passively transferred antibodies in the patient's blood may lead to false-positive results in serological tests.
Passive transfer of antibodies directed against erythrocyte antigens, such as A, B, and D, may interfere with certain serological tests for anti-erythrocyte antibodies, such as the direct antiglobulin test (DAT, direct Coombs test).

Incompatibilities and special handling precautions
This medicinal product must not be mixed with other medicinal products or with any other product containing IVIg.
The medicinal product should be used immediately after first opening.
The medicinal product should be brought to room or body temperature before use.
Before administration, the solution should be visually inspected. The solution should be clear or slightly opalescent and colorless or pale yellow. Turbid solutions or those containing precipitates must not be used.
